Tyson Dino nuggets
CARBS
17g
PROTEINS
14g
FATS
17g
Quantity: 5 nuggets
Glycemic Index: Medium
Glycemic Load: 8
Fiber: 1g
Key Nutrients: Protein, Fat
Health Impact: May cause moderate blood sugar spikes due to carbohydrate content and processing. The fat and protein can slow digestion, slightly moderating the insulin response.
💉 Suggested Bolus
Consider pre-bolusing insulin or using a dual-wave bolus to manage the slower digestion from fats.

⏱ Blood Sugar Timeline
- 0–15 min: Minimal impact as protein and fat digest slower than simple carbohydrates.
- 30–60 min: A moderate rise in blood sugar may occur, depending on the amount consumed and individual insulin sensitivity.
- 2–3 hr: Blood sugar levels should begin to stabilize as the protein's effects continue to modulate glucose absorption.

🤔 FAQs about Tyson Dino nuggets
Can I eat Tyson Dino nuggets on a low-carb diet?
Tyson Dino nuggets contain breading which adds carbs; opting for unbreaded, grilled meats is a better choice for maintaining lower blood sugar levels.
